SDBS及腐殖酸对涕灭威及其氧化产物水解的影响

摘    要: 研究了腐殖酸(胡敏酸,HA和富里酸,FA)和表面活性剂十二烷基苯磺酸钠(SDBS)对氨基甲酸酯农药涕灭威及其氧化产物涕灭威亚砜和涕灭威砜的水解作用的影响.结果表明,SDBS可以促进涕灭威及其氧化产物的水解,随着SDBS的浓度由0增加为1200mg/L,涕灭威,涕灭威亚砜和涕灭威砜的水解速率常数K值分别增加了约8倍,7倍和6倍.腐殖酸可抑制涕灭威及其氧化产物的水解.在pH值为12的水溶液中,当FA的浓度由0增大到1000mg/L时,涕灭威,涕灭威亚砜和涕灭威砜的水解速率常数K值分别下降了83%,50%,68%;随着HA的浓度由0增大到1000mg/L时,涕灭威,涕灭威亚砜和涕灭威砜的水解速率常数K值分别下降了45%,56%,22%.研究结果对受农药污染土壤的修复有一定的指导意义.

The influences of sodium dodecylbenzenesulfonate and humus on hydrolysis of aldicarb and its oxidation products

Abstract:The influences of surfactant sodium dodecylbenzenesulfonate (SDBS) and humus (humic acid, HA and fulvic acid, FA) on hydrolysis of pesticide aldicarb and its oxidation products (aldicarb sulfoxide and aldicarb sulfone) were studied. The results showed that SDBS could promote the hydrolysis; and with the concentration of SDBS increasing from 0mg/L to 1200mg/L, the hydrolysis rate constant K values of aldicarb, aldicarb sulfoxide and aldicarb sulfone increased by a factor of 8, 7 and 6 respectively. Humus could inhibite the hydrolysis of aldicarb and its oxidation products. In water solution of pH=12, with the concentration of FA increasing from 0mg/L to 1000mg/L, the hydrolysis rate constant K values of aldicarb, aldicarb sulfoxide and aldicarb sulfone decreased by 83%, 50% and 68% respectively; and with the concentration of HA increasing from 0mg/L to 1000mg/L, these K values decreased by 45%, 56% and 22% respectively. These results are useful for directing the renovation of pesticide polluted soil.
